This is a literary survival guide to the middle years for women with teenage children, elderly parents and husbands in crisis. Written for women, by women, The Hey Nonny Club started life as a loose collection of women who had troubles in their life. Here is an address on middle age; its joys, its dilemmas and its compensations. By sharing monologues and poems, these women helped each other and now they : would like to help you.
